Caving in Mpumalanga
Caving in Mpumalanga

Explore the Hidden Depths

Venture underground and discover Mpumalanga’s mysterious world of caves, where history, geology, and adventure collide. From the legendary Sudwala Caves to the atmospheric tunnels near Sabie, caving in Mpumalanga is an immersive adventure activity that takes you deep into the Earth’s secret chambers.

Sudwala Caves, one of the oldest known cave systems in the world, has a storied past: from storing ammunition during the Second Boer War to the legends of the lost Kruger Millions. Today, explorers wander through vast chambers filled with awe-inspiring stalactites, stalagmites, and intricate flowstone formations. For thrill-seekers, the Crystal Tour offers a hands-on journey into hidden depths, revealing the raw beauty of the subterranean world.

For a different kind of thrill, caving by candlelight near Sabie transforms tunnels into moody, mysterious passageways, perfect for muddy crawls and close encounters with the Earth’s rugged underbelly. Whether you’re a history buff, geology enthusiast, or adrenaline-seeker, caving in Mpumalanga promises a unique combination of discovery, wonder, and adventure.
